Website with a Page Builder or Custom Development?

Ari
Updated 6.2.2025
Sivunrakentajat (page builder) vai räätäläöiden (custom) vaihtoehtoine verkkosivuston uudistamisessa.

Summary

  • The technical approach to website redevelopment should be determined based on goals.
  • There are no inherently wrong technologies, only careless choices.
  • There are several excellent ways to implement a website, such as custom solutions using ACF (Advanced Custom Fields) and Gutenberg, as well as various page builder solutions. Ideavirta implements all of these approaches.

Selecting the Best Approach for Your Website

The technical implementation of a website should align with business needs and objectives. The choice is often between two approaches: using page builders or developing a custom solution. Both have their advantages and limitations. If you encounter discussions claiming one approach is the only right way, don’t worry—there is no absolute right or wrong way to build a website.

The best solution is determined by the client’s goals and project requirements. This article explores the differences between these two approaches and helps you determine the right one for your business.

Implementation with Page Builders

Page builders were introduced to offer an easier, more DIY-friendly way to build websites. This approach became popular in website and small e-commerce development, providing a lightweight solution for a specific customer segment.

However, page builders have not replaced the traditional method of separating design and technical implementation. Instead, they complement conventional approaches by introducing another option for different types of projects. Often, page builders are used in cases where less design work is needed.

Advantages of Page Builders

  • Page builders integrate structure, visual design, and content creation into a single tool, reducing the need for separate tools and processes.
  • If the user has sufficient knowledge of design, structure, and content creation, a page builder can be an efficient solution for small to medium-sized projects.

Challenges of Page Builders

  • Page builders can create the illusion that everything is easy to do. Their ease of use may lead users to overestimate their abilities, only to face unexpected difficulties.
  • If the user lacks an understanding of visual, structural, and content-related aspects, working with a page builder can be confusing. Proper use still requires knowledge of web development principles, such as responsiveness optimization.
  • Managing the visual and structural integrity of a page builder-based site requires discipline and vision. The risk is an inconsistent design due to the “anything is possible” nature of the tool.
  • Enhancing or modifying a page builder-based site can be more time-consuming since customizations are often applied page-by-page or even element-by-element.
  • The HTML/CSS/JS output generated by page builders is often bulkier, leading to heavier server loads. This can slow down page load times, which affects SEO performance.

Custom Development

For larger and strategically significant projects, such as a brand overhaul or a company’s communication strategy development, custom solutions are often the better choice. A more effective and higher-quality approach separates high-level design and technical implementation into distinct phases. This method allows for prototyping and review before technical development begins, making it a more design-driven website renewal process.

Advantages of Custom Development

  • Rapid brand development and evaluation through prototyping.
  • Agile modeling of structures and user journeys, enabling a better user experience assessment.
  • Prototyping allows stakeholders to experience content in a near-final format before full implementation.
  • Custom solutions rely on standardization, which is beneficial for managing large websites efficiently.
  • Custom development often utilizes WordPress’s Gutenberg blocks or the popular ACF plugin, allowing for fixed or easily adjustable design elements and functionalities.
  • Properly developed custom Gutenberg or ACF implementations are more lightweight, leading to optimized loading speeds. Google approves of this.

Challenges of Custom Development

  • Custom development requires careful planning of UI and structures.
  • The combined process of design and technical implementation is generally more labor-intensive compared to page builders, which should be reflected in the project budget.
  • This method demands project management skills and dedicated focus on each stage, making it less suitable for clients with tight schedules.
  • Since the site structure and content are standardized, introducing entirely new layout models requires planning and the technical implementation of new content components.

Conclusion

Page builders are a great choice for small to medium-sized projects where speed and cost-efficiency are priorities. Custom solutions, on the other hand, are ideal for strategic projects focused on improving key aspects such as branding, usability, or search engine visibility.

There are multiple approaches to building a website, and both methods can produce high-quality results in skilled hands.

At Ideavirta, we are proficient in various technological solutions, including page builders like Divi, Elementor, Bricks, and Beaver Builder. We also specialize in fully custom solutions using Gutenberg and ACF.

Article content